Kundalini Yoga A Synapse of the Body, Mind, Soul & the Spirit By Ashok Bedi, M.D. Individuation is the process of the integration of the opposites in our Psyche at successively higher thresholds of our potential under the auspices of the guiding wisdom of our soul (Self). In the Hindu roadmap of individuation, we must attend to the four tasks of the Psyche or Chaturvarga, including Artha (Wealth & Security), Kama (Eros & relationships), Dharma (Spiritual purpose) and Moksha (Freedom from the opposites in the Psyche). To attend to these tasks, me must engage the body, mind, soul and align it with the intentions of the Spirit or Brahamna at the seven levels of integration. The practice of Yoga in general and the Kundalini Yoga in particular is an ancient template to attend to the Magnum Opus of our individuation process from an Eastern/Hindu perspective.
